Did you check the volatage on the battery? Did you make sure the connectors are on tight and that you did not undo the ground for the battery. Is the car turning over at all and just not starting?

If it is not cranking over then start with the basics. Check that or reply if all that is good.

Did you pull a plug and ground it out to see if you are getting spark?
